Catalog description

The main goal of this course is to provide graduate students in nutrition with critical thinking and problem-solving skills in conducting and evaluating nutrition research. This will be accomplished by learning about research design, ethics in conducting research, statistical methodologies (quantitative), critiquing journal articles and by solving problem sets using the statistical software SPSS.
